W212 350 Sport 60k miles.
Noticed that the oil level is too high on the dipstick (awkward thing to use, how did they design that?)
Using my oil extraction pump I removed about 1 1/2 litres to get it down to the high mark.
Wonder whether its been overfilled or is it possible that diesel has got into the sump?
Most of my journeys are 30/40 miles before another cold start.
Thinking I might just suck out the lot and refill with fresh, just bought 20 litres of gen Mercedes oil from that place in S Wales for £70 on Ebay. Not sure your model but the tailgate lights are normally held in place by two philips screws then simply pull down and out. The lens is also the bulb holder. The sprung metal bulb retainers get loose and may need a gentle nip up with a pair of long nose pliers and a scrub with some sand paper.

Does mercedes recomend to check oil when hot?
Yes. According to the Owner's manual, the engine should be switched off for approximately five minutes if the engine is at normal operating temperature before the level is checked.

Alternatively, if the engine is not at normal operating temperature, e.g. if the engine was only started briefly, wait approximately 30 minutes before carrying out the measurement.

1.5 litres is quite a lot for an overfill, if the oil has been contaminated by diesel you should drain and refill with fresh oil. I understand this can arise due to faulty injectors, faulty high pressure fuel pump, or due to unburnt diesel as a result of aborted dpf regenerations which is most likely. There seems to be a common problem with modern diesels doing short journeys, resulting in unburnt diesel finding its way into the sump, it seems German manufacturers utilise this system whereby an extra squirt of diesel is introduced into the exhaust to raise dpf temperatures when all criteria are met to do the dpf regeneration. If you google it you'll be amazed how common a problem it is.
I had similar problem recently and had to siphon off 1 litre. I then decided to do full oil change in case it was diesel contamination, and am doing regular check on oil level in case of reoccurrence. Unfortunately I mainly do short journeys during week so am fearing diesel contamination, as per car handbook I now ensure that car is driven for at least 20 mins at full running temperature on motorway at constant speed every 300 miles to enable proper regen, hindsight is wonderful but I shall be switching to petrol at next car change.

Sorry to hear of your oil worries - excess diesel from aborted regeneration of the DPF is a possibility.

On the face of it your 30/40 mile commute should be enough to initiate a DPF regen but then it rather depends whether that's 30/40 miles of fast motorway use or the same in stop/go traffic.

Ideally to initiate a regen the engine needs a constant throttle at 1,500 - 2,000+RPM for a reasonable period of time (10 mins or more) but with our road traffic that's often not the case and a modern 3litre diesel will pretty much be ticking over at legal motorway speeds.

Before you change the oil I would suggest getting the engine up to temp and then doing a motorway run at a quiet time of day (such as late evening) where you can lock the car in a lower gear, to achieve a constant 2,000 rpm and then run at those revs for 10 - 20 mins. Do the return journey in the same way and then let the car return to normal operation for the last 5 miles or so.

Next change the oil/filter, note your level and once a week for a month try and do a 'DPF run' - then see whether your oil is remaining within normal levels.

If not, then it's worth looking at the possibility of faulty injector/s and getting a leak-off test done.

After filling-up with fresh oil, the engine should be brought up to working temperature with car on level ground, then switched-off for 5 minutes, and the oil level checked.

For petrol, it should be a smidgen under the top mark on the dipstick.

For Diesel, it should be halfway between the top and bottom marks on the dipstick (i.e. 1L short of full capacity).

Not sure if this is written in any book or manual... but this is how I used do it.

Engines normally consume oil, and some have minor leaks / 'sweating'.

It's OK to run on Min if you check the engine oil level frequently (most people don't).

Topping-up above the Min is a reasonable comprise to safeguard against engine wear due to gradual oil loss.

Petrol engines' oil capacity will rarely go up (though petrol or coolant contamination are possible), and even when they do the damage is unlikely to be significant, typically no more than a bad oil leak.

Diesel engines on the other hand can see the oil level rise due to contamination with Diesel fuel, and the results can be devastating for the engine.

Additionally, petrol and coolant tend (to some extent) to clear the engine oil through evaporation and the engine breather system, while Diesel fuel cannot be removed from engine oil.

For this reason it is recommended to leave more margin for unintended oil quantity increase on Diesel engines than on petrol engines.

But again - this what I do and has been handed down to me by older mechanics I worked with... not sure if it's official or documented.
